| Comments: |
Snowshoed the whole loop. Spring snow in the lower elevations, loose granular up high. Breakable crust in woods. Upper ledges on Blueberry Ledge Trail were fairly well blown in with snow. Some blue ice lurking, but nothing bad. Pretty smooth sailing for this trail. Two icy areas on Rollins Trail with no fall zones, but one can bushwhack around them if uncomfortable. Monorail starting to lurk under lower Dicey's Mill - step off the center of the trail and sink with snowshoes on. |
